[0041] The present invention adopts a client / server architecture, the server is responsible for functions such as data collection, calculation, and database reading and writing, and the client implements specific business processes and performs information interaction with the server.

[0042] Server program (comprising data acquisition module, data processing and storage module, demand calculation module) of the present invention is installed on server, client program (comprising parameter setting module, demand prediction and control module) of this system is installed on client , load control scheme and alarm information management module, demand analysis module, time-of-use electricity cost analysis and optimization module). Abstract

The invention discloses an industrial enterprise power utilization load optimizing system which belongs to the field of enterprise power load scheduling. The industrial enterprise power utilization load optimizing system is characterized in that hardware comprises a relationship database server, an application server, a client end PC, a real-time database server and the like, wherein the application server is connected with the real-time database server for carrying out data interaction, the application server is connected with the relationship database for carrying out data storage and reading, the client end PC is connected with the application server for carrying out information interaction; and the application module comprises a data acquisition module, a data processing and storing module, a demand computing module, a parameter setting module, a demand predicting and controlling module, a load control scheme and alarm information managing module, a demand analyzing module and a time-sharing power rate analysis optimizing module. The invention has the advantages of a power utilization plane with minimum cost in further of the enterprise through demand analysis and time-sharing power rate analysis optimization, and the purposes of transferring peaks and balancing valleys, balancing loads, prolonging the service life of electric equipment, and reducing power utilization cost of the enterprise.

technical field [0001] The invention belongs to the field of enterprise electric load dispatching, and in particular provides an industrial enterprise electric load optimization system. Background technique [0002] Industries such as iron and steel, electrolytic aluminum, and copper smelting are industries that consume a lot of electricity. Enterprise users in these industries are charged with the two-part electricity price of large industrial electricity. capacity electricity charge or demand electricity charge) and adjust electricity charge composition.
